New Graduate Nurse Program
Job Title: Registered Nurse Location: Rochester General Hospital/ Unity Hospital/ United Memorial Medical Center/ Newark Wayne Hospital/ Clifton Springs Hospital Hours Per Week: 36 to 40 Hours Schedule: Day/Evening and Evening/Night shifts (with every other weekend) available based on Unit SUMMARY We are excited to offer the opportunity to start as a Graduate Nurse on a Limited Permit to December 2024 and May 2025 graduates. For December Graduates: Application is opened until December 1st For May Graduates: Application is opened until May 1st The Graduate Nurse Program provides all-inclusive support to kick-start your nursing profession: + Classroom-based Clinical Orientation (2 weeks) + Comprehensive Unit-Based Orientation (8 weeks) + NCLEX Bootcamp (weekly in classroom review for 5 weeks - PAID): + ATI NCLEX Review (virtual asynchronous): Access to ATI NCLEX Review as a supplement to the NCLEX Bootcamp. + Nurse Residency Program: Participation in our Nurse Residency Program RESPONSIBILITIES: + Patient Care & Service: Promote and restore patients' health by completing the nursing process; collaborating with physicians and multidisciplinary team members; performing various treatment procedures; providing physical, educational and emotional support to patients, friends and families; supervising assigned team members + Planning & Communication: Develop and document individualized care plans customized for each patient’s unique needs, with support from the interdisciplinary health team as needed; maintain effective communication to convey patient health status, treatment plans and progress + Electronic Health Record (EHR) Management: Demonstrate proficient use of an EHR – including accurate patient and provider documentation and communication + Compliance: Adhere to required department and system protocols, regulations (local, state, federal) and education requirements RE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S: + Diploma or Associate’s Degree in Nursing + Registered Nurse license in New York State + Basic Life Support (BLS) certification P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S: + Bachelor’s Degree in Nursing preferred WE’RE HERE FOR YOU: + Our Benefits | Rochester Regional Health Careers (https://careers.rochesterregional.org/you-belong-here/our-benefits/) EDUCATION: AS: Nursing (Required) LICENSES / CERTIFICATIONS: BLS - Basic Life Support - American Heart Association (AHA)American Heart Association (AHA), RN - Registered Nurse - New York State Education Department (NYSED)New York State Education Department (NYSED) P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S: M - Medium Work - Exerting 20 to 50 pounds of force occasionally, and/or 10 to 25 pounds of force frequently, and/or greater than negligible up to 10 pounds of force constantly to move objects; Requires frequent walking, standing or squatting.
